英英释义

sticky

[ \'stiki ]

adj.

having the sticky properties of an adhesive

同义词:glueyglutinousgummymucilaginouspastyviscidviscous

moist as with undried perspiration and with clothing sticking to the body

\"felt sticky and chilly at the same time\"

hot or warm and humid

\"sticky weather\"

同义词:muggysteamy

hard to deal with; especially causing pain or embarrassment

\"a sticky question\"

同义词:awkwardembarrassingunenviable

covered with an adhesive material

词组短语

sticky rice

n. 糯米

sticky tape

胶带

sticky fingers

偷盗习惯;小偷小摸的人

双语例句

用作形容词(adj.)I am uncomfortable because my body is sticky .我身上粘粘的,很不舒服。Yuanxiao is a kind of sticky round dumplings.元宵是一种粘粘的圆的面团。A hot, sticky day makes a person listless.天气闷热使人觉得身上有气无力。They put me in a sticky position.他们将我置于一个困难的境地。The boss was rather sticky about giving me leave.老板有些不情愿让我请假。
